The Opportunity:
We are seeking a highly experienced and visionary Senior Staff Software Engineer with deep expertise in Artificial Intelligence to lead the AI team at Authorize.Net. This role involves driving the design, development, and deployment of AI-powered solutions to enhance our payment processing platform. The ideal candidate will have a strong background in software engineering, AI/ML, and team leadership, with a passion for innovation and delivering high-impact solutions.
Essential Functions:
- Lead the AI team in designing and implementing AI-driven features and enhancements for the Authorize.Net platform.
- Collaborate with cross-functional teams, including product management, data science, and engineering, to define AI strategies and roadmaps.
- Architect scalable and robust AI solutions that align with business goals and technical requirements.
- Mentor and guide team members, fostering a culture of innovation, collaboration, and continuous improvement.
- Stay current with industry trends and emerging technologies in AI and software engineering.
- Ensure the quality, performance, and security of AI applications through rigorous testing and code reviews.
- Drive the adoption of best practices in AI development, including model training, evaluation, and deployment.
